4.1 E-Bus (fi g. 6)
Cable type 24 AWG 7 x Ø 0,2 mm is recommended.
The to tal length of the E-Bus cable must not exceed
500 m. The E-Bus must be connected to the cen tral
control unit (B1-, B2, B3, B4+). It may be routed in
parallel to other accessories. If shielded cable is used,
all the shields must be connected at one point, e.g. at

4.3 Inputs (fi g. 7)
All inputs can be operated in modes 1 to 4 and 6 to
7 (fig. 7). Inputs Z1 to Z2 can also be operated with
Z
glass break alarms. To do this, the relevant switches
SW1 to SW2 must be closed and one terminal of each
